Trooper Ernest Wardle

Profile image
Poppy image

Military service

Service number: D/46744
Age: 29
Rank: Trooper
Force: Army
Unit/Regiment: Royal Canadian Armoured Corps
Birth: February 15, 1918 Wigan, Lancashire, England
Enlistment: September 27, 1940 Montreal, Québec
Death: October 9, 1947 Atherleigh Welfare Home, Leigh, England

Burial/memorial information

Grave reference: Ground 4. Grave 784.
Additional information

Son of Fred and Sarah Elizabeth Wardle, of Atherton, Lancashire, England. Brother of Fred and Bob. Husband of Greta Wardle, of Atherton, Lancashire, England.

Additional citations

1939-45 Star, Italy Star, Defence Medal, Canadian Volunteer Service Medal and Clasp, War Medal 1939-45.

ATHERTON CEMETERY Lancashire, United Kingdom
